West Side of Park Drive in Stanley Park Reopens After Trees Downed from Last Night's Storm RemovedJanuary 6, 2007 (No. 1) - Park Board staff report that the west side of Park Drive will reopen at noon today, reinstating access to Prospect Point Café, Sequoia Grill and the west side of the park, after a number of trees fell across roadways during last night's wind storm. It is expected that access to North Lagoon Drive will reopen by 2:00 PM today following the removal of several trees blocking access to that roadway. The public should be aware that access to park facilities is open, including restaurants and the Aquarium, but are reminded to stay out of forested areas and to respect barricades placed on trails. - 30 - For more information contact Carol DeFina, Communications Coordinator, at 604-257-8440.
